While I don't care much for Lesnars antics the dude is a beast. Beyond his size and strength he is not some slow, cumbersome heavyweight like a Tim Sylvia. He is quick for his size and has a solid chin. The biggest advantage Lesnar has over any of the four in that article is his wrestling, his wrestling background usually just gets mentioned casually but the dude destroyed people on the high school and college levels. His college record was like 106-5. That's insane. We are starting to see in MMA and the UFC that while being well rounded is definitely a must, a strong wrestling background or skills can negate holes in your game. Look at guys like Couture, GSP, Matt Hughes, etc, they were/are dominant and it is usually because they can take their opponents off of their feet an dump them on their head, back, neck, against the cage, or wherever. Forget the hype that is BJJ, strong wrestlers are dominant. Just for fun go back and watch Gracie/Hughes when Gracie said his style would still work in todays UFC, granted I would say he was out of his prime but he was still game and he got owned.
